What is the primary function of reverse osmosis?

Prepare for the NGWA Exam with customized flashcards and comprehensive multiple choice questions. Each question is paired with hints and detailed explanations to optimize learning. Ace your groundwater exam efficiently!

The primary function of reverse osmosis is to remove dissolved ions from water. This process involves the use of a semi-permeable membrane that allows water molecules to pass through while blocking a significant portion of dissolved solids, contaminants, and even some larger molecules. As pressure is applied to the water, it forces it through the membrane, effectively separating pure water from unwanted dissolved substances, including salts, heavy metals, and other impurities.

This method is widely used in various applications such as desalination, water purification for drinking water, and industrial processes where water quality is crucial. The effectiveness of reverse osmosis in reducing the concentration of dissolved ions makes it a critical technology for obtaining clean and safe water, contributing to public health and environmental sustainability.
